[0018] The present invention will be further described below in conjunction with the accompanying drawings.

[0019] Such as Figure 1 to Figure 3 The shown one-to-one heat dissipation LED module includes a lampshade 1, a heat dissipation component, a substrate 2 and several LED light sources 3 packaged on the substrate 2. The lampshade 1 is sealedly connected with the heat dissipation component and forms an accommodation space. The substrate 2 Installed in the accommodating space, the heat dissipation assembly includes a heat dissipation bottom plate 4 fixedly connected with the lampshade 1, the base plate 2 is attached to the bottom of the heat dissipation bottom plate 4, and the upper part of the heat dissipation bottom plate 4 is provided with a number of positions corresponding to the LED light source 3. The corresponding heat dissipation unit 5, the heat dissipation bottom plate 4 and the heat dissipation unit 5 are all made of aluminum alloy.

Abstract

The invention discloses a one-to-one heat dissipation LED module. The one-to-one heat dissipation LED module comprises a lampshade, a heat dissipation component, a substrate and a plurality of LED light sources packaged on the substrate, wherein the lampshade is in matched connection with the heat dissipation component to form an accommodating space, the substrate is arranged in the accommodating space, the heat dissipation component comprises a heat dissipation base plate fixedly connected with the lampshade, the substrate is attached to the bottom of the heat dissipation base plate, and a plurality of heat dissipation units in one-to-one correspondence to the LED light sources in position are arranged on the upper portion of the heat dissipation base plate. In work, independent heat dissipation is conducted on each LED light source by the corresponding heat dissipation unit, the effective area of each heat dissipation fin is fully utilized, heat conduction velocity and heat convection coefficient are increased, heat dissipation of all parts is more uniform, and heat dissipation performance is better; furthermore, due to the fact that each heat dissipation unit conducts heat dissipation on a single LED light source, the area of each heat dissipation fin can be reduced, and therefore the whole size is smaller and the whole weight is lower.

technical field [0001] The invention relates to the technical field of LED modules, in particular to a one-to-one heat dissipation LED module. Background technique [0002] LED has many advantages such as environmental protection, energy saving, and long life, and has gradually become the best choice for energy-saving renovation of road lighting. However, since the LED light source is installed inside the closed body, a large amount of heat will be generated during operation. If it cannot be discharged in time, the temperature of the P-N junction will rise rapidly, which will accelerate the light decay of the LED, and even lead to devastating thermal breakdown. Therefore, LED lamps need to be provided with heat dissipation components for heat dissipation.
